The Mariners scored 100 fewer runs than any other AL team and had an OPS of .637, the only AL team below .700. Baltimore's pitching was only marginally worse in 2018 than it had been the year before, but the offense bottomed out, going from middle of the pack to dead last in the American League in runs, batting average and OBP. The end result was a decade in which the Mariners never made the playoffs, extending their postseason drought to 18 years (the longest active run by any North American pro sports team as of 2019).
